Forecast: Total Sand Sole Production in Capture Fisheries in Italy

The forecasted production of sand sole in Italy's capture fisheries shows a steady upward trend from 2024 to 2028. In 2024, production is projected at 45 metric tons, with subsequent annual increases leading to 68 metric tons by 2028. Compared to 2023, the continuous rise in production levels indicates a healthy growth trajectory, suggesting optimism for the sector. The year-on-year growth rates reflect robust market conditions, with consistent increases enhancing Italy's sand sole supply.

Future trends to watch for include:

  • Potential regulatory changes affecting capture fisheries.
  • Technological advancements in sustainable fishing practices.
  • Environmental factors impacting sand sole populations.
  • Market demand variations due to dietary shifts or economic changes.
